Crandall, TX vs Manvel, TX
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Crandall is 25.5% cheaper than Manvel. With a cost index of 97 vs 130,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Crandall to Manvel should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Crandall is $1,274/month compared to $2,270/month in Manvel — a 44%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Crandall is more affordable at $272,900 median vs $321,600.
Median household income in Crandall is $105,556 compared to $113,938 in Manvel (-7.4%). Manvel does offer higher incomes, but the salary premium barely offsets the higher cost of living, leaving residents with a tighter budget. Looking at affordability, residents of Crandall spend roughly 14.5% of their income on rent, less than the 23.9% in Manvel.
